You were at the intersection of Meeting & Broad Streets, it’s referred to as the four corners of law. Originally you had City Hall (city law), County Court House (state law), the Federal Court House (federal law) & St. Michael’s Episcopal Church (gods law) with one on each corner. If you continued walking down Meeting Street across Broad you would be South Of Broad and those that live South Of Broad are referred to locally by some as SOB’s, not as in son of a ……. but South Of Broad.
